These are the top problems with the 1st generation Chevy Silverado 2500, which includes model years 1999 to 2007. In this video Len points out the most common problems reported on this generation of Silverado. He offers tips and suggestions on the best way to take care of those problems yourself!

Re ABS: is this suggesting the ABS light the (bad ground) causes the light to turn on, and the ABS and brakes are not affected, or is there An ABS system problem?
wondering this myself
the ground under the drivers door is a big issue with the abs on these trucks, but it effects alot of other things too. and weirdly enough one thing can act up because this ground is bad, but not affect other things.
+kenman1717 Thanks for the tip!
is this an easy fix?
@@longjonz88 Yes, remove the bolt on the body mount where the grounds connect, clean up with scotch brite, put back on with some dielectric grease (tuneup grease) to keep from corroding. Easy peezy to do
I’ve replaced the actual motors on the gauge cluster. It did the trick! Can you do a video on the trailer button on the shift handle?
Exactly on the gauge cluster. They're called stepper motors. De-solder old ones, solder new ones. There are a bunch of RUclips videos showing the procedure.
Yeah unfortunately the motors for the gauges going bad is a pretty common thing with the instrument clusters in these trucks. I spent seven years working at Delphi building clusters for these trucks and other GM vehicles and there were some supplier quality issues with the stepper motors

The driver side driving light burns out on all of those pickup trucks I've seen many including my own is because they use a bulb from the brake light which is brighter than the running light but by doing that the brake light filament is not design for a constant burn therefore overheating overloading the socket and burning it up. So after replacing your burn up socket try switching the pigtails to pull on the running light circuit of the bulb instead of the brake light turn signal circuit of the bulb and no more issues. I am surprised at all they did not nention.
One... These LS motors are horrible to have oil pressure issues, many say it is the oil pickup tube o ring, but i suspect the pressure release valve in the pump is often the trouble. The bad thing is how hard they are to cha ge especially on 4x4.
Two, the stepper on the fan motor. They start losing the abilities in lower settings. You will typically see them only woeking on a couple of places mine was 4th and 5th speed. It is not too bad to replace once the cover is off.
Three a d a huge one is the oil pressure sending unit at the back top of engine. Pain to get to and goes out often.
Four, someone already mentioned the brake lines rust out, but also gas lines rust easily, and the cab corners also rust super fast. Seems like chevy would have made them more resistant being a work truck with 4x4.
Five, the sensors for the gas fumes go bad. The one most common is the one near the gas tank. They often get clogged, tge dumb thing is chevy put them at several different locations and sometimes like on my truck it is nearly impossible to get out.
Six, the drive by wire or heard ir callsd "fly by wire" systems suck! I have had lots of trouble with the throttle boddies, but the sensors between the gas peddle and throttle body has to read very closly or it sends your truck into the dreaded "reduced power mode" aka limp... this is very dangerous id you are pulling a load.. you cant go anywhere if it goes in this mode when hauling. Super sketchy/scary in traffic. It should have a bypass button to get you out of traffic at least.
Seven, someone else mentioned this... the hydronost on these trucks is crap. WhEN it goes out and it will go out it takes out both your power steering and your brakes! It usually starts leaking well before and if you are putting in lots of power steering fluid... that is likely the problem.
Eight, everything seems to leak on these trucks. The oil cooler lines will not be easy to change either WHEN they go out.
And all of the ones mentioned in the video. ESPECIALLY the guage cluster. It os usually a connection issue. The stepper motors are bad to go out too. This guy made out like oh just have it relearn the cluster lol that is not likely the problem. And he said "replace the cluster" well they are NOT cheap like everything else, get ready to spend.
One addition tid bit...If you have lots of flickering on the lights, check to see if someone tried to use LED bulbes, this truck does not like those bulbes. It also does not like any of the add on things that work off the trailer hitch wiring. It will do some crazy things.

Gauge cluster, easy fix. Bad solder joints on mother board. Pull cluster, separate mother board after you remove needles. Have a tv repair shop inspect and re-solder as needed the resistors and diodes on the mother board. Plug in motherboard to re-zero stepper motors, and install needles to zero.
Install back in truck.
